Senior Site Manager

Burgess Hill | Permanent | www.cv-library.co.uk |
We have a great new opportunity for a Senior Site Manager to join our team within South East based at our site in Burgess Hill, West Sussex. As our Senior Site Manager, you will be responsible for effectively motivating, supporting and managing the site-based team to ensure that the required health, safety and environmental performance standards are achieved.
You will achieve the programme and quality requirements and promote the importance of customer relationships to the site-based team to include directly employed and sub-contracted staff.

More about the Senior Site Manager role...
Ensure compliance with the Company's health and safety and environmental policies and procedures.
Maintain all statutory records on a daily/weekly basis as required.
Ensure that all staff, sub-contractors and visitors to the site are appropriately inducted.
Prepare and maintain traffic management and site strategy and review as required.
Follow Company guidelines in relation to accident and incident reporting procedures.
Assess the site prior to the start of the working day responding to any emergencies and addressing any areas of risk.
Regularly walk all areas of the site to observe general standards of health and safety and take remedial action as appropriate.
Ensure all trades are using the appropriate personal protective equipment and are working in a safe environment and manner.
Attend health and safety and other training courses are required by the Company.
Ensure the site is secure at the end of each day.
Ensure that all plant is inspected on a daily/weekly basis.
Include health and safety and environment on the agenda for all site team meetings.
Keep the health and safety compendium up to date at all times.
Accompany health and safety advisors during site visits and undertake remedial action as appropriate.

We're Vistry Group, the UK's leading provider of affordable mixed-tenure homes. Our core values of integrity, caring, and quality shape all we do; our partnership-led approach helps us build sustainable communities where they're needed most.

You're probably familiar with our unmatched portfolio of brands: Linden Homes, Bovis Homes and Countryside Homes. We also have Vistry Works, our timber frame manufacturing operation, and Vistry Services, our support functions. Together, we build more than homes, so there's nowhere better to build your career.
